Cleaning up after Wilma

By Overhall · Comments (2)

I just got back from Florida where Hurricane Wilma did some great damage. I traveled down the east coast from St. Augustine to Hollywood, FL and saw too many “blue” roofs, which is blue tarp to those that don’t know. One of my “brothers” lost his roof and was lucky that much wasn’t damaged in his home, yet the scene on the streets told a different story for many. Discarded applicances, cabinets, furniture and more ruined from water.
